  78/**
  79 *      fb_alloc_cmap - allocate a colormap
  80 *      @cmap: frame buffer colormap structure
  81 *      @len: length of @cmap
  82 *      @transp: boolean, 1 if there is transparency, 0 otherwise
  83 *
  84 *      Allocates memory for a colormap @cmap.  @len is the
  85 *      number of entries in the palette.
  86 *
  87 *      Returns negative errno on error, or zero on success.
  88 *
  89 */
  90
  91int fb_alloc_cmap(struct fb_cmap *cmap, int len, int transp)
  92{
  93    int size = len*sizeof(u16);
  94
  95    if (cmap->len != len) {
  96        fb_dealloc_cmap(cmap);
  97        if (!len)
  98            return 0;
  99        if (!(cmap->red = kmalloc(size, GFP_ATOMIC)))
 100            goto fail;
 101        if (!(cmap->green = kmalloc(size, GFP_ATOMIC)))
 102            goto fail;
 103        if (!(cmap->blue = kmalloc(size, GFP_ATOMIC)))
 104            goto fail;
 105        if (transp) {
 106            if (!(cmap->transp = kmalloc(size, GFP_ATOMIC)))
 107                goto fail;
 108        } else
 109            cmap->transp = NULL;
 110    }
 111    cmap->start = 0;
 112    cmap->len = len;
 113    fb_copy_cmap(fb_default_cmap(len), cmap);
 114    return 0;
 115
 116fail:
 117    fb_dealloc_cmap(cmap);
 118    return -ENOMEM;
 119}
 120
 121/**
 122 *      fb_dealloc_cmap - deallocate a colormap
 123 *      @cmap: frame buffer colormap structure
 124 *
 125 *      Deallocates a colormap that was previously allocated with
 126 *      fb_alloc_cmap().
 127 *
 128 */
 129
 130void fb_dealloc_cmap(struct fb_cmap *cmap)
 131{
 132        kfree(cmap->red);
 133        kfree(cmap->green);
 134        kfree(cmap->blue);
 135        kfree(cmap->transp);
 136
 137        cmap->red = cmap->green = cmap->blue = cmap->transp = NULL;
 138        cmap->len = 0;
 139}
 140
 141/**
 142 *      fb_copy_cmap - copy a colormap
 143 *      @from: frame buffer colormap structure
 144 *      @to: frame buffer colormap structure
 145 *
 146 *      Copy contents of colormap from @from to @to.
 147 */
 148
 149int fb_copy_cmap(const struct fb_cmap *from, struct fb_cmap *to)
 150{
 151        int tooff = 0, fromoff = 0;
 152        int size;
 153
 154        if (to->start > from->start)
 155                fromoff = to->start - from->start;
 156        else
 157                tooff = from->start - to->start;
 158        size = to->len - tooff;
 159        if (size > (int) (from->len - fromoff))
 160                size = from->len - fromoff;
 161        if (size <= 0)
 162                return -EINVAL;
 163        size *= sizeof(u16);
 164
 165        memcpy(to->red+tooff, from->red+fromoff, size);
 166        memcpy(to->green+tooff, from->green+fromoff, size);
 167        memcpy(to->blue+tooff, from->blue+fromoff, size);
 168        if (from->transp && to->transp)
 169                memcpy(to->transp+tooff, from->transp+fromoff, size);
 170        return 0;
 171}

 201/**
 202 *      fb_set_cmap - set the colormap
 203 *      @cmap: frame buffer colormap structure
 204 *      @info: frame buffer info structure
 205 *
 206 *      Sets the colormap @cmap for a screen of device @info.
 207 *
 208 *      Returns negative errno on error, or zero on success.
 209 *
 210 */
 211
 212int fb_set_cmap(struct fb_cmap *cmap, struct fb_info *info)
 213{
 214        int i, start, rc = 0;
 215        u16 *red, *green, *blue, *transp;
 216        u_int hred, hgreen, hblue, htransp = 0xffff;
 217
 218        red = cmap->red;
 219        green = cmap->green;
 220        blue = cmap->blue;
 221        transp = cmap->transp;
 222        start = cmap->start;
 223
 224        if (start < 0 || (!info->fbops->fb_setcolreg &&
 225                          !info->fbops->fb_setcmap))
 226                return -EINVAL;
 227        if (info->fbops->fb_setcmap) {
 228                rc = info->fbops->fb_setcmap(cmap, info);
 229        } else {
 230                for (i = 0; i < cmap->len; i++) {
 231                        hred = *red++;
 232                        hgreen = *green++;
 233                        hblue = *blue++;
 234                        if (transp)
 235                                htransp = *transp++;
 236                        if (info->fbops->fb_setcolreg(start++,
 237                                                      hred, hgreen, hblue,
 238                                                      htransp, info))
 239                                break;
 240                }
 241        }
 242        if (rc == 0)
 243                fb_copy_cmap(cmap, &info->cmap);
 244
 245        return rc;
 246}

 282/**
 283 *      fb_default_cmap - get default colormap
 284 *      @len: size of palette for a depth
 285 *
 286 *      Gets the default colormap for a specific screen depth.  @len
 287 *      is the size of the palette for a particular screen depth.
 288 *
 289 *      Returns pointer to a frame buffer colormap structure.
 290 *
 291 */
 292
 293const struct fb_cmap *fb_default_cmap(int len)
 294{
 295    if (len <= 2)
 296        return &default_2_colors;
 297    if (len <= 4)
 298        return &default_4_colors;
 299    if (len <= 8)
 300        return &default_8_colors;
 301    return &default_16_colors;
 302}
